Riding for the Disabled Association of Victoria (RDAV) delivers life-changing equestrian programs for children and adults with disability. For more than 55 years, RDAV has supported riders to build physical strength, balance and coordination, while also growing confidence, communication and social connection — all in a safe, structured and joyful environment with horses.
Our vision is a Victoria where people with disability can participate fully in community life, with equal access to sport, recreation and meaningful connections. Our mission is to improve health and wellbeing through evidence-informed, horse-assisted programs delivered by accredited coaches and a dedicated community of volunteers.
RDAV addresses the barriers that people with disability often face in accessing inclusive sport and recreation — including cost, limited local options, and a shortage of trained support. With a statewide network of centres and thousands of volunteers, we are well-placed to expand access, strengthen safety and horse welfare standards, and lift participation in both metropolitan and regional communities.
Our current priorities include increasing rider opportunities, developing and retaining volunteers and coaches, improving systems and governance, and building sustainable fundraising to secure RDAV’s future.
Funding through Australian Communities Foundation will help RDAV grow participation, train volunteers and coaches, support horse care and equipment, and invest in modern systems that improve safety, reporting and the participant experience. RDAV is endorsed as a Deductible Gift Recipient (DGR1), enabling donors to make tax-deductible gifts that directly support riders and their families.
